Frisco is a Collin and Denton county city about 30 miles north of downtown Dallas, with approximately 225,000 residents. The community was incorporated in 1908 along the St. Louis-San Francisco Railway, which gave the town its shortened name. Population remained under 10,000 as late as 1990, after which master-planned residential development and corporate relocations drove growth faster than almost any other U.S. city of comparable size.
The Star, a 91-acre development completed in 2016, serves as the Dallas Cowboys' World Corporate Headquarters and includes the Ford Center at The Star, a 12,000-seat indoor stadium used for team practices and Frisco ISD high school football games. FC Dallas, the MLS franchise, plays at Toyota Stadium on the east side of the city. Stonebriar Centre, a regional shopping mall, opened in 2000 and anchors the commercial zone along the Dallas North Tollway.
Frisco Independent School District enrolls over 65,000 students and has added nearly 60 new campuses since 1996. The IKEA store, the Cowboys' Ford Center, Toyota Stadium, and the Dr Pepper Ballpark (home of the Frisco RoughRiders, the Double-A affiliate of the Texas Rangers) together form a concentrated entertainment and commercial zone unusual for a city of this size.
